Hello plugin authors,

Next Thursday, Corbexa will run a disaster-recovery drill for the RestockRoute vending-machine restock planner. During the failover window, plugin callbacks will be replayed against the standby scheduler, so please ensure your handlers are idempotent and tolerate duplicate route assignments. No customer restock data will be altered. To re-register your plugin against the standby environment during the drill, authenticate with the recovery passphrase provided below.

vault phrase of hahip-tajeg = quenax-briath-briax

## Authentication

Matchbox (the pairing service) exposes GC pause metrics at `/internal/gc`. Pauses over 400ms page on-call. The endpoint is behind the Kestrelgate proxy; anonymous calls return 403. Auth is a static service key in the `X-Matchbox-Key` header — no OAuth, no refresh. Keys rotate quarterly; stale keys fail closed, which looks identical to a network partition, so check auth first. The current on-call key for the GC metrics endpoint is below.

API key for kahap-faduf: vxb23-Ir087IkWYmBJt7KRtkyhUA3

Unsigned files are quarantined automatically and deleted after seven days. Place your plugin archive and its detached signature in your assigned incoming directory; the ingest job runs hourly and validates both files together. If validation fails, you'll see a rejection notice in your outbox directory with the reason attached. The ingest service verifies all uploads against the platform's current public verification key, which is provided below.

deploy key for bajog-kageg: bky4_TaoL

**Q: Feewright rules engine won't load the new shipping-fee ruleset — what now?**

A: This happens when the ruleset bundle is signed but the verifier cache is cold. Restart the Feewright evaluator, re-run validation, and redeploy. If the signed bundle store itself is sealed, the release manager must unseal it manually. Enter the recovery passphrase printed below.

recovery phrase for fajeg-hagug: holox-fenmir